Facilities Ticket — Floor 6 Opening, Brantley Square

The new sixth floor opens Monday. Desk assignments for the Meridian Tools team have been loaded into the seating planner, and the kitchenette will be stocked by Friday. Team assistants should walk their groups through the space before move-in day and report any snagging issues through the facilities queue. Until badge profiles sync overnight, assistants can open the stairwell door with the temporary code below.

badge for fafop-fajof: bdg-Z-47

**Ticket: Config drift on ScanBridge workers**

Hey, quick one for review. The ScanBridge barcode scanner integration at the Fennwick warehouse has drifted — two of the four workers are running an older decoder timeout and a different retry cap than what's in the repo. Probably from Marco's hotfix last sprint that never got merged back. I've reconciled everything to match prod-intended values. Please sanity-check before I roll it out. Current live config on worker-3 follows.

service settings:
[casax]
port = 6379
team = rusir
host = casax.zemvarhq.corp
region = outer-4
access_code = ac_9808ce
timeout_ms = 1500

- [ ] New team members, note: the Tallyforge billing worker uses blue-green deploys, and key rotation happens only while the green stack is idle. Verify no invoices are mid-settlement on green, then cut traffic fully to blue and confirm the queue depth reads zero for five consecutive minutes. Rotate the worker's signing key, redeploy green, and run the smoke-charge test against the sandbox ledger. When the test charge reconciles, seal the retired key and record its recovery passphrase on the line below.

recovery phrase for yahag-yagap: pramir-normir-norius-kasax

## Onboarding: The Reconnect Saga (Project Lanternfish)

So, the websocket reconnect bug. Short version: clients reconnecting after an idle timeout sometimes replayed a stale session token, and the gateway accepted it, causing ghost sessions. The fix shipped in 3.2.1 — reconnects now require a fresh signed handshake, and the gateway rejects anything older than 30 seconds. As release manager, you'll re-sign the handshake bundle every release; the pipeline does most of it. The signing material you'll need is below.

rollout seal: bky19_M1Zvn1YQwEBTy4XxP3H